Fast Nondeterministic Matrix Multiplication via Derandomization of Freivalds’ Algorithm [PDF]
We design two nondeterministic algorithms for matrix multiplication. Both algorithms are based on derandomization of Freivalds’ algorithm for verification of matrix products. The first algorithm works with real numbers and its time complexity on Real RAMs is O(n2logn). The second one is of the same complexity, works with integer matrices on a unit cost

A Nondeterministic Polynomial-Time Unification Algorithm for Bags, Sets and Trees [PDF]
Unification in logic programming deals with tree-like data represented by terms. Some applications, including deductive databases, require handling more complex values, for example finite sets or bags (finite multisets). We extend unification to the combined domain of bags, sets and trees in which bags and sets are generated by constructors similar to ...

Nondeterministic Moore automata and Brzozowski’s minimization algorithm
AbstractMoore automata represent a model that has many applications. In this paper we define a notion of coherent nondeterministic Moore automaton (NMA) and show that such a model has the same computational power of the classical deterministic Moore automaton.

Nondeterministic functional transducer inference algorithm
The purpose of this paper is to present an algorithm for inferring nondeterministic functional transducers. It has a lot in common with other well known algorithms such has RPNI and OSTIA. Indeed we will argue that this algorithm is a generalisation of both of them.
